You will focus on cleaning communal areas and undertaking grounds maintenance as a lone worker or in pairs on our schemes across the Exeter and surrounding area. Key Responsibilities Maintain Communal Areas: Ensure that stairwells, walkways, laundry areas, and communal rooms are cleaned, kept tidy, and well-maintained. Grounds Maintenance: Keep communal garden areas neat and well-kept using appropriate tools and equipment. Area Upkeep: Regularly clean and disinfect bin areas to maintain hygiene standards. Minor Maintenance: Perform minor repairs in communal areas and report any issues requiring specialist attention. Customer Interaction: Act as the first point of contact for customers, addressing their concerns and directing them to the appropriate teams. This role is being offered on a full time, permanent basis working 37 hours per week. This is a field based role covering Exeter and the surrounding area. We are committ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of vulnerable groups. Appointment to this role is subject to a satisfactory basic DBS check. About The Candidate To be successful in your application for the role of Estate Supervisor, you will have the essential skills and experience for a level 1 role (please see candidate information pack) and the following role specific skills and experience: Ability to carry out cleaning, grounds maintenance and caretaking duties to a high standard. Confident with simple IT such as MS Office, and willing to learn and use repairs reporting systems and other necessary IT packages. Ability to work with minimal supervision. Ability to make decisions confidently in order to resolve issues and deliver excellent customer service. Applies a practical approach to problem solving taking practical steps where required in order to achieve successful outcomes for estate and customers. Ability to handle difficult situations calmly, professionally at all times taking proactive approach to avoiding confrontation. Demonstrable practical skills either in a work or home environment. Full, valid UK manual driving licence. Desirable: Previous experience of Estate Caretaking/Maintenance. Our Reward and Benefits Generous Annual Leave: Start with 26 days, plus bank holidays, increasing to 30 days with length of service - and the option to purchase up to 5 extra days (pro rated for part time roles). Pension Contributions: Enjoy up to 9% employer contributions with our Defined Contribution scheme. Health Benefits and Perks: Access to a health care cash plan (worth up to £1,100 annually), virtual GP services, discounted gym memberships, and retail discounts including access to a Blue Light Card. Learning and Development: Invest in your future with ongoing personal and professional growth opportunities. Family Support: Policies designed to help you balance work and family life, including a new child payment. Wellbeing Matters: Prioritise your health with mental health support, enhanced sick pay, wellness campaigns, and free flu jabs. Smarter Travel: Save with our Cycle to Work and Car Benefit schemes. Giving Back: Up to four paid volunteering days a year to support our communities.
